Hemostasis is a crucial process that prevents excessive blood loss from damaged blood vessels. It involves various mechanisms such as vasoconstriction, platelet adhesion and activation, and fibrin formation. The importance of each mechanism depends on the type of vessel injury. In contrast, thrombosis is the abnormal formation of a blood clot within the blood vessels, leading to potential complications if the clot obstructs blood flow. Varicose veins, or varicosities, are abnormally dilated and twisted superficial veins caused by venous valve incompetence. This condition commonly affects the lower extremities, especially the saphenous veins, due to the higher pressure from prolonged standing and walking. 恶性瘤,前血栓突变,以及静脉血栓形成的风险.

Jeanet W Blom1, Carine J M Doggen, Susanne Osanto

  • 1Department of Clinical Epidemiology, Leiden University Medical Center, Leiden, The Netherlands.

JAMA
|February 11, 2005
PubMed
概括

癌症患者面临着明显更高的静脉血栓形成风险,特别是在诊断后的几个月内或有远程转移. 像Faktor V Leiden这样的基因突变进一步提高了这种风险.

科学领域:

  • 在瘤学瘤学.
  • 血液学 血液学 血液学
  • 遗传学 是一个遗传学.

背景情况:

  • 静脉血栓是癌症患者常见和严重的并发症,影响他们的生活质量.
  • 识别患有血栓形成风险较高的癌症患者对于主动管理至关重要.

研究的目的:

  • 为了评估癌症患者的血栓形成风险.
  • 评估瘤部位,转移和原血栓突变对这种风险的影响.

主要方法:

  • 一项病例控制研究 (MEGA) 涉及3220名静脉血栓症患者和2131名对照.
  • 通过调查问卷和DNA分析收集的数据用于因子V莱登和前列红蛋白20210A突变.

主要成果:

  • 癌症患者患静脉血栓的风险增加了7倍.
  • 血液,肺和胃肠道癌症构成最高的风险.
  • 在诊断后的最初几个月,患有远程转移,以及携带V因子Leiden或前列血20210A突变的携带者中,风险明显更高.

结论:

  • 癌症患者,特别是那些最近被诊断出癌症或转移的患者,有明显增加的静脉血栓形成的风险.
  • 血栓前基因突变放大了这种风险,强调了个性化风险评估的需要.
